When is the Best Time of the Winter for Snowboarding?

But because winter weather is often unpredictable, serious snowboarders tend to analyze several factors when deciding on the best place and the best time of the winter for snowboarding. Having just a lot of snow in the environment is not enough to make a decision to snowboard.
There are some hardcore snowboarders who still prefer to strut their stuff at the height of winter, even though they face conditions like cloudy skies, mild-to-strong winds, heavy snowfall and less comfortable temperatures. Of course during the height of winter, winter resorts charge high on their services and lodging. There are some trends that money-conscious people are noticing and the snowboarders among them are gradually making adjustments not just to get the best value of their time and money, but also free themselves of the risks that come with harsh winter conditions during the season’s height. One can take a look at Colorado, a long time haven for skiers, snowboarders and tourists. Some people noticed that during the winter season there, the resorts experience really slow business specifically during periods between major national holidays. Any snowboarder who wants to take advantage of discounted rates at the resorts can go there between New Year’s Day and Martin Luther King, Jr. Day. If not, the slow business trend between Martin Luther King, Jr. Day and the President’s Day weekend is another great opportunity for snowboarding.
Other than the discounted rates on the accommodations and services of the resorts of those specific periods, snowboarders can also take advantage of the snowy but calmer weather. The cold is not that harsh, the sky is clearer and at the same time the environment still has sufficient snow to ride over. Arguably, January to the second half of February is the best time of the winter for snowboarding.
